GS4B032261BAT Description

GS4B032261BAT Description

The GS4B032261BAT from TT Electronics/IRC is a high-precision 7-resistor bussed network in an 8-pin narrow SOIC package. Designed for surface-mount applications, it features a ceramic thin-film construction with a 0.1% absolute tolerance and ±25ppm/°C temperature coefficient, ensuring exceptional stability across a wide temperature range (70°C to 125°C). Each resistor offers a 2.26KΩ resistance with a 0.05W (1/20) power rating per element and a total power rating of 0.4W. The gull-wing termination and SOIC-C case style facilitate reliable PCB integration, while its 100V maximum voltage rating makes it suitable for demanding circuits.

GS4B032261BAT Features

  • Precision Performance: ±0.1% tolerance and ±0.05% ratio tolerance for critical analog/digital signal conditioning.
  • Robust Construction: Ceramic substrate and thin-film technology ensure low noise and high reliability.
  • Thermal Stability: ±25ppm/°C TCR minimizes resistance drift in fluctuating environments.
  • Compact & Durable: 4.9mm × 5.99mm × 1.45mm dimensions with ±0.1mm height/length tolerances for tight PCB layouts.
  • Automation-Friendly: Tube packaging and gull-wing leads streamline pick-and-place assembly.
